Medium Composition
Composition (per liter)
Histidine — 0.5 g
Raffinose — 2.5 g
Dipotassium Phosphate Trihydrate (K2HPO4·3H2O) — 1.0 g
Magnesium Sulfate Heptahydrate (MgSO4·7H2O) — 0.5 g
Ferrous Sulfate Heptahydrate (FeSO4·7H2O) — 0.01 g
Calcium Chloride — 0.02 g
Agar — 20.0 g
Final pH: 7.2 ± 0.2 (25°C)
Directions for Use
- Suspend 24.5 g of the medium in 1 liter of distilled or deionized water.
- Heat to boiling for approximately 1 minute until completely dissolved.
- Dispense the medium into appropriate containers.
- Sterilize by autoclaving at 121°C for 15 minutes.
- Allow the medium to cool and pour into sterile petri dishes if agar plates are required.
